PEP-159 is a 15 amino acid synthetic peptide whose sequence is from human parkin. The sequence of this peptide is (amino to carboxy terminus): C- I (298)-K-E-L-H-H-F-R-I-L- G-E-E-Q-Y-N (313)
This peptide may be used for neutralization and control experiments with the polyclonal antibody that reacts with this product and human parkin, catalog # PA1-751. Using a solution with equal weights per unit volume of peptide and corresponding antibody will yield a solution with a large molar excess of peptide that is able to competitively bind the antibody.
Reconstitute with 0.1 mL of distilled water.
The precise function of Parkin gene is unknown; however, the encoded protein is a component of a multiprotein E3 ubiquitin ligase complex that mediates the targeting of substrate proteins for proteasomal degradation. Mutations in this gene are known to cause Parkinson disease and autosomal recessive juvenile Parkinson disease. Alternative splicing of this gene produces multiple transcript variants encoding distinct isoforms. Additional splice variants of this gene have been described but currently lack transcript support.
